As a matter of clarification the amounts of money in the previously
supplied S106 Tracker were listed against an address under ‘Multiple
Bids’, the addresses corresponded with a site where a financial
contribution as a result of a development that gained planning permission,
was received. 

The amount was not spent on 175A Brigstock Road, it was received as a
result of development on this site.  The £7,948.75 formed part of the
£30,124.20 funding to improve Trumble Gardens.  The project lead has
confirmed expenditure has occurred in 2023/24.  The funding was assigned
for removal of large overgrown trees and replacement fixed planters and
walls, and install a relocated entrance gate and fence.
